Proving Medical malpractice or negligence

In order to win a birth injury lawsuit, you have to first prove that medical negligence or malpractice occurred. It isn't easy to prove that a healthcare professional didn't adhere to a standard of care that could be expected of other medical professionals in similar situations. This is the reason that led to the injuries to your child. Your lawyer will make use of medical invoices and records, expert witness testimony, and other evidence to prove this.

In addition to proving negligence and causation in addition, you must establish damages. These damages are meant to provide you and your family members for the effects your child's injuries have affected your life, including future and past medical costs, lost incomes in the event of discomfort and pain as well as disability.

Gathering Evidence

If you're filing an action against a doctor, hospital or nurse, anesthesiologist or any other medical professional, it's important to gather all evidence relevant as soon as you can. This includes medical records, expert opinions, and any other evidence that supports the claims made in your case. An attorney can assist in seeking these records and ensure that they aren't lost or destroyed in the course of litigation.

You'll need to prove that the medical professional did not fulfill their duty during your birth experience. This means that the healthcare professional did not exercise the same level of care and expertise that an appropriately skilled medical professional would under similar circumstances. If you can prove that the healthcare provider breached their duty of caring and resulted in the birth injury of your child, you may be entitled to financial compensation.

In the event of birth injuries the first step is to establish that a medical professional owed you and/or your child a duty. This is a standard of care that all healthcare professionals must follow. Due to their training and expertise, specialists such as obstetricians are held to higher standards. Your lawyer will build your case around this standard and the circumstances of your child's birth to demonstrate that the medical professional acted in violation of their duty and caused the injuries to your child.

Finally, your attorney will assist you to establish the damages you've suffered due to the injuries your child sustained. This includes non-economic and economic damages, like pain and suffering. The amount of damages you receive can have a significant effect on your ability to live your life with your child.

In many cases, settlements can be reached without going to court. Some cases will be heard in a trial in which a jury or judge will decide on the amount you are entitled to for your injuries.
